Body cells do not undergo meiosis. Reproductive cells undergo meiosis, body cells, mitosis.
Meiosis is important for the production of gametes (sperm and eggs) in humans.

Meiosis in females occurs in the ovaries. The process of meiosis is responsible for the formation of eggs (ova) in females.
